Output 75a67d391dd31d9a7528ef0e799ede44f19909147d03766ff0337927424d0698:1

value
977581114
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8e750b68ed2ece7418b5209b8d93eb87213fe6b OP_EQUALVERIFY OP_CHECKSIG
address
1Ph5geDrGK8grn3Gn1dYaRA8diStXiEhkT
transaction
75a67d391dd31d9a7528ef0e799ede44f19909147d03766ff0337927424d0698
spent
true